I'm with http://www.ifastnet.com, they offer 350MB space, 1x MySQL database, and PHP access with phpMyAdmin. Your domain looks like this: http://yourname.ifastnet.com <> oh and of course you get an FTP account.
(Mine is http://sudomania.ifastnet.com)
The other option, which I'd prefer in a way is http://www.po.gs because you get all of the above, but 50MB only, however your domain looks like this: http://www.yourdomain.po.gs The reason I'm not with them is because they have an "English Country policy" where you have to be either from USA, UK, Australia, Canada etc. And they only sign 25 random lucky users per week. So if you sign up it's not to say you'll get hosting. I was with them before they had this policy though, but I was stupid and sold my domain (whilst I could have kept it) and now I'm with ifastnet.
which is better except for the long name.
For domains you can try this: http://www.freedomain.co.nr/ You will get a free .co.nr domain. or you can get a free .tk domain but loaded with ads and popups. The first one I mentioned has no ads, popups or anything. As long as you get 1 visitor a week on ur site they are happy.
Paid domains I'd say http://www.godaddy.com or http://www.register.com
